Throttle Position Sensor (TPS)

The TPS is a variable resistor which is operated by movement of throttle shaft. It is mounted on the throttle body and senses throttle blade opening angle.

The sensor produces a voltage signal that varies with throttle angle. This signal is transmitted to the SMEC where it is used to adjust air/fuel ratio during acceleration, deceleration, idle and wide open throttle conditions.
